-"""PySide2 Charts example: Simple memory usage viewer"""
-
-import os
-import sys
-from PySide2.QtCore import QRect, QSize, QProcess
-from PySide2.QtWidgets import QApplication, QMainWindow
-from PySide2.QtCharts import QtCharts
-
-def runProcess(command, arguments):
- process = QProcess()
- process.start(command, arguments)
- process.waitForFinished()
- std_output = process.readAllStandardOutput().data().decode('utf-8')
- return std_output.split('\n')
-
-def getMemoryUsage():
- result = []
- if sys.platform == 'win32':
- # Windows: Obtain memory usage in KB from 'tasklist'
- for line in runProcess('tasklist', [])[3:]:
- if len(line) >= 74:
- command = line[0:23].strip()
- if command.endswith('.exe'):
- command = command[0:len(command) - 4]
- memoryUsage = float(line[64:74].strip().replace(',', '').replace('.', ''))
- legend = ''
- if memoryUsage > 10240:
- legend = '{} {}M'.format(command, round(memoryUsage / 1024))
- else:
- legend = '{} {}K'.format(command, round(memoryUsage))
- result.append([legend, memoryUsage])
- else:
- # Unix: Obtain memory usage percentage from 'ps'
- psOptions = ['-e', 'v']
- memoryColumn = 8
- commandColumn = 9
- if sys.platform == 'darwin':
- psOptions = ['-e', '-v']
- memoryColumn = 11
- commandColumn = 12
- for line in runProcess('ps', psOptions):
- tokens = line.split(None)
- if len(tokens) > commandColumn and "PID" not in tokens: # Percentage and command
- command = tokens[commandColumn]
- if not command.startswith('['):
- command = os.path.basename(command)
- memoryUsage = round(float(tokens[memoryColumn].replace(',', '.')))
- legend = '{} {}%'.format(command, memoryUsage)
- result.append([legend, memoryUsage])
-
- result.sort(key = lambda x: x[1], reverse=True)
- return result

-class MainWindow(QMainWindow):
-
- def __init__(self):
- super(MainWindow, self).__init__()
-
- self.setWindowTitle('Memory Usage')
-
- memoryUsage = getMemoryUsage()
- if len(memoryUsage) > 5:
- memoryUsage = memoryUsage[0:4]
-
- self.series = QtCharts.QPieSeries()
- for item in memoryUsage:
- self.series.append(item[0], item[1]);
-
- slice = self.series.slices()[0]
- slice.setExploded();
- slice.setLabelVisible();
- self.chart = QtCharts.QChart()
- self.chart.addSeries(self.series);
- self.chartView = QtCharts.QChartView(self.chart)
- self.setCentralWidget(self.chartView)
-
-if __name__ == '__main__':
- app = QApplication(sys.argv)
- mainWin = MainWindow()
- availableGeometry = app.desktop().availableGeometry(mainWin)
- size = availableGeometry.height() * 3 / 4
- mainWin.resize(size, size)
- mainWin.show()
- sys.exit(app.exec_())
